What does DDU mean in Medical & Science

DDU meaning is defined below:

Dual Diagmosis Unit
ADVERTISEMENT

Was it useful?

What does DDU mean? It stands for Dual Diagmosis Unit

Most popular questions

What does DDU stand for?


DDU stands for "Dual Diagmosis Unit"

How to abbreviate "Dual Diagmosis Unit"?


"Dual Diagmosis Unit" can be abbreviated as DDU

What is the meaning of DDU abbreviation?


The meaning of DDU abbreviation is "Dual Diagmosis Unit"

What does DDU mean?


DDU as abbreviation means "Dual Diagmosis Unit"

Related Acronym Searches